Akıllı algoritmalar kullanılarak mini bir robotun forvet futbol oyuncusu olarak geliştirilmesi

dc.contributor.advisorAltun, Yusuf
dc.contributor.authorYılmaz, Kadir Uğur
dc.date.accessioned2021-02-25T15:02:36Z
dc.date.available2021-02-25T15:02:36Z
dc.date.issued2018
dc.departmentDÜ, Fen Bilimleri Enstitüsü, Bilgisayar Mühendisliği Ana Bilim Dalıen_US
dc.descriptionYÖK Tez No: 528905en_US
dc.description.abstractGol atmanın birçok yolu vardır. Bu yollardan birisi de kaleci ile karşı karşıya kalındığı zaman atılan gollerdir. Çalışmadaki amaç ise robota yapay zekâ tekniklerinden bulanık mantık algoritması eklenerek robotumuzu ileri uç oyuncusu olarak geliştirmektir. Çalışma da İleri uç oyuncusunun kaleci ile karşı karşıya kaldığında, kaleciyi geçebilmek için yaptığı çalımlama işlemi incelenmiştir. Oluşturduğumuz robot ve robotun içine yazdığımız kodlar yardımıyla; önüne engel çıktığında, neler yapması gerektiği robota aktarılmıştır. Yapay zekânın bir kolu olan bulanık mantık algoritması ile de robota yazılan algoritmalarla düşünebilme imkânı sağlanmıştır. Bulanık Mantık (BM) algoritması oluşturulurken robotun kaleye ve kenarlara olan uzaklıkları değişken olarak seçilmiştir. Robotun kenarlara olan uzaklıkları kaleciyi geçmesi için, kaleye olan uzaklığı ise robotun topa vurma hızını belirlemek için önemlidir. Kullanılan BM algoritmaları; oluşturulan robotun üzerinde bulunan Ardunio Nano'ya yüklenen kod satırları ile kullanılabilir duruma getirilmiştir. Bu algoritmalar oluşturduğumuz saha yardımıyla siminize edilmiştir. Matlab programının "Fuzzy Logic ToolBox" kısmı yardımıyla bu algoritmalar incelenmiş ve sonuçlar analiz edilmiştir. Böylelikle bu çalışma ile BM, futbol ve robot teknolojisi birleştirilmiştir.en_US
dc.description.abstractThere are many ways to score a goal. One of these ways is the goals scored when facing the goalkeeper. The aim of the study is to develop our robot as a forward player by adding fuzzy logic algorithm from robotic artificial intelligence techniques. Study; When the goalkeeper is confronted, the process of running the football forward player to pass the goal has been investigated. With the help of the codes we have written into the robot and robot we have created; Robot has been transferred to what he needs to do when he gets in the way. Fuzzy logic algorithm, which is a branch of artificial intelligence, is also provided with the ability to think with algorithms written in robota. When the fuzzy logic algorithm is constructed, the distances of the robot to the trough and the edges are chosen to be variable. The distances of the robot to the edges are used for passing the ball, and the distance to the ball is important for determining the speed at which the robot hits the ball. Fuzzy logic algorithms used; was made available with the lines of code uploaded to Ardunio Nano on the generated robot. These algorithms were simulated with the help of the field we created. These algorithms were examined with the help of the "Fuzzy Logic ToolBox" part of Matlab program and the results were analyzed. Thus, Fuzzy logic, football and robot technology are combined with this study.en_US
dc.identifier.endpage55en_US
dc.identifier.startpage1en_US
dc.identifier.urihttps://tez.yok.gov.tr/UlusalTezMerkezi/TezGoster?key=fS4sqEZr79C_n60Rk6MjFarMooDKs3yDH5v6S7903Vma5ARwYQ3Vvq2vmFvI-AwI
dc.identifier.urihttps://hdl.handle.net/20.500.12684/7070
dc.institutionauthorYılmaz, Kadir Uğuren_US
dc.language.isotren_US
dc.publisherDüzce Üniversitesien_US
dc.relation.publicationcategoryTezen_US
dc.rightsinfo:eu-repo/semantics/openAccessen_US
dc.subjectBil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olen_US
dc.subjectComputer Engineering and Computer Science and Controlen_US
dc.titleAkıllı algoritmalar kullanılarak mini bir robotun forvet futbol oyuncusu olarak geliştirilmesien_US
dc.title.alternativeBeing developed of algorithm for the forward player by using fuzzy logicen_US
dc.typeMaster Thesisen_US

Dosyalar

Orijinal paket
Listeleniyor 1 - 1 / 1
Yükleniyor...
Küçük Resim
İsim:
528905.pdf
Boyut:
1.67 MB
Biçim:
Adobe Portable Document Format
Açıklama:
Tam Metin / Full Text

Koleksiyon